Abstract :
A monolithic 8-bit two-step flash type A/D converter has been designed. To obtain full resolution and good linearity at high frequencies, a double folding analog signal processing system is used. Delay time errors between the coarse and the fine quantizes used can be corrected for in this system. An on-chip input amplifier allows adjustment of the input sensitivity with a high input impedance and a low input capacitance. the 3 x 4.2 mm/sup 2/ chip made in a standard bipolar technology consumes 100 mA from a 5.2 V supply.
